It is very unlikely this will lead to anything. I spent a year working in Western Togoland (near the town of Hohoe) and the (majority of) people in the region see themselves as Ghanaian above all else. Without widespread support there is no way these ‘separatists’ will succeed. In fact according to reports the Ghanaian government first thought this declaration of independence was a joke!
